Swift Action Leads to Recovery of Stolen Bike in Mango, Jamshedpur

Jamshedpur’s Mango police station efficiently recovers a stolen bike within 24 hours, earning accolades and honour from local Congress leader, Pappu Singh.

JAMSHEDPUR – A bike stolen from Samta Nagar, under the jurisdiction of Jamshedpur’s Mango police station, was swiftly recovered within a span of 24 hours.

The bike was reportedly stolen on Tuesday and was later found in the Bada Bazar area of Purlia district in Bengal state.

Alongside the recovery of the stolen vehicle, the thief was also apprehended.

Impressed by the quick action of the Mango police, local Congress leader Pappu Singh chose to honor the station’s Inspector with a bouquet.

Singh also urged the police to continue combating crime with the same level of efficiency.

The vehicle owner has since been reunited with the recovered bike.
